Output 999aedc3563d343c2c76edc0a33dcba49795e1594004e245f135a60cb14351ed:6

value
95195746564
script pubkey
OP_0 OP_PUSHBYTES_20 a70dd391bacaeecbd66542c6b4cf49bc066c5104
address
tb1q5uxa8yd6ethvh4n9gtrtfn6fhsrxc5gyqa7uwa
transaction
999aedc3563d343c2c76edc0a33dcba49795e1594004e245f135a60cb14351ed
confirmations
503
spent
true